"In" the court signifies being physically seated (or standing) inside the courtroom.
"On" the court signifies being involved possibly in the game of Basketball.

This varies from state to state. The summons should tell you the amount of time you have to answer. If it does not say, contact the court clerk or an attorney in your area.
